The League of YES recently partnered with Long Island Cares and Sachem East Baseball volunteers for a meaningful food drive focused on giving back and supporting families in need across Long Island.
Held this past Saturday, the event brought together players, buddies, volunteers, and community members in a shared effort to help fight food insecurity and support Long Island Cares’ mission of building a hunger-free Long Island.
Student-athletes from Sachem East Baseball joined League of YES participants and volunteers in collecting donations and helping make the event a success. The collaboration highlighted the power of teamwork, inclusion, and community service while creating an opportunity for students to make a positive impact beyond the field.
Long Island Cares expressed gratitude for the generosity and kindness shown by everyone involved, recognizing the important role community partnerships play in supporting local families and individuals in need.
